What happened between Angie and David Bowie?

After nine years of marriage, Angie and David Bowie separated, and they divorced on February 8, 1980, in Switzerland. In the divorce settlement, she received £500,000, paid in installments, and a 10-year gagging clause. Not wanting to fight over custody, she left their son with David.


Did David Bowie have a child with Angie Bowie?

Bowie has two children in total. The singing superstar had Duncan with first wife Angie Bowie, and Alexandria Zahra Jones, with second wife Iman Abdulmajid.


Did David Bowie have a child with his first wife?

Bowie (born David Jones) also has a son, Duncan Jones, with his first wife, Angie, whom he was married to between 1970 and 1980.
